Pet wellbeing company Paws.com has launched its Chow Down Challenge, aiming to provide 250,000 meals to shelter dogs by the end of the summer.

To get involved people will need to, share a video photo or GIF of their pup ‘chowing down’ their dinner to Facebook Instagram or Twitter, mention #BuyFoodGiveFood and @Paws and nominate and tag three friends.

This campaign follows the “Buy Food, Give Food” initiative, with Paws donating a meal to a shelter dog for every subscription order, which has seen just under £50,000 worth of food donated.

Neil Hutchinson, founder of Paws, said: “In 2018 we launched a mission to tackle pet abandonment. Buy Food, Give Food is an initiative which helps the UK’s brilliant independent dog shelters, many of whom struggle to get funding and afford healthy meals for their dogs.

“We’re hoping that the Chow Down Challenge will spread the word even further about these unsung heroes, and we can’t wait to see what the nation’s dog-loving community has to share. We know they will make a difference to those all important meal donations, these amazing shelters and their brave dogs.”
